Profit Boosters from Loyal Customers

.Organizations adore brand-new consumers, but regular purchasers generate more income and cost less to solution.Clients need to have an explanation to return. It can include motivated advertising, impressive service, or even exceptional item quality. Irrespective, the long-lasting practicality of a lot of ecommerce stores calls for folks that obtain much more than as soon as.Listed here's why.Much Higher Life-time Market Value.A regular customer possesses a greater life time market value than one that creates a single acquisition.Point out the normal order for an online shop is $75. A customer who acquires the moment and never ever profits generates $75 versus $225 for a three-time purchaser.Right now point out the online shop possesses one hundred customers every quarter at $75 every transaction. If simply 10 consumers purchase a second time at, again, $75, overall earnings is $8,250, or even $82.50 each. If 20 buyers yield, income is $9,000, or $90 each on average.Loyal consumers are actually really satisfied.Better Advertising and marketing.Return on advertising and marketing invest-- ROAS-- measures an initiative's efficiency. To figure out, partition the profits created coming from the advertisements by the cost. This resolution is typically shown as a ratio, such as 4:1.An outlet creating $4 in purchases for every single advertisement dollar possesses a 4:1 ROAS. Thereby a service with a $75 consumer life-time value going for a 4:1 ROAS could invest $18.75 in marketing to acquire a solitary purchase.But $18.75 will drive couple of consumers if competitions devote $21.That is actually when shopper retention and also CLV come in. If the outlet might acquire 15% of its own customers to purchase a second time at $75 every acquisition, CLV will increase coming from $75 to $86. A normal CLV of $86 with a 4:1 ROAS intended suggests the shop can easily commit $22 to obtain a customer. The outlet is actually now reasonable in a business along with an average accomplishment expense of $21, and it may keep brand new clients rolling in.Lesser CAC.Consumer achievement cost derives from several factors. Competitors is actually one. Ad premium as well as the stations concern, as well.A brand-new business generally depends upon established add platforms such as Meta, Google, Pinterest, X, as well as TikTok. The business offers on positionings as well as spends the going price. Reducing CACs on these platforms requires above-average transformation rates from, state, exceptional advertisement imaginative or even on-site checkout flows.The circumstance contrasts for a company with devoted as well as most likely interacted customers. These businesses have other alternatives to drive revenue, like word-of-mouth, social proof, events, and competition advertising. All could possess considerably lesser CACs.Reduced Client Service.Replay buyers normally have fewer concerns as well as solution communications. Individuals who have acquired a t-shirt are confident concerning match, premium, as well as cleaning guidelines, as an example.These replay buyers are less most likely to return a product-- or chat, email, or phone a client service division.Greater Earnings.Imagine 3 ecommerce companies. Each obtains 100 clients each month at $75 per typical order. However each possesses a different client retentiveness cost.Shop A maintains 10% of its own consumers every month-- one hundred overall customers in month one as well as 110 in month 2. Shops B as well as C possess a 15% and twenty% regular monthly retention rates, respectively.Twelve months out, Store A will have $21,398.38 in sales from 285 consumers-- 100 are actually brand-new and 185 are loyal.On the other hand, Shop B will certainly have 465 consumers in month 12-- one hundred new as well as 365 regular-- for $34,892.94 in sales.Outlet C is actually the large champion. Maintaining twenty% of its own customers monthly will cause 743 clients in a year and also $55,725.63 in purchases.To be sure, keeping twenty% of new shoppers is a determined goal. Nonetheless, the instance presents the compound impacts of customer retention on earnings.
